Speech-Language Pathologist
The Community Access Unlimited team provides support to individuals with intellectual and/or developmental disabilities. Such supports include but are not limited to housing, community integration, daily living skills, and employment.
We are seeking a passionate and dedicated speech-language pathologist to join our team in a full-time, community-based role. The SLP will provide evaluation and treatment services across multiple locations, including day program, home, and community environments. A primary focus of this position is conducting augmentative and alternative communication (AAC) evaluations and supporting individuals in accessing and using AAC systems in their daily lives. This is an excellent opportunity for a newly graduated clinician completing their Clinical Fellowship Year (CFY).
We especially encourage Spanish- and/or ASL-fluent individuals to apply, as well as those with an interest or background in AAC. Our team is committed to supporting the growth of new clinicians — significant on-site mentorship and supervision will be available throughout your fellowship year. Join a passionate, mission-driven nonprofit dedicated to empowering adults with disabilities to communicate, connect, and thrive in their communities.
Education/Experience
Master's degree in speech-language pathology. Current NJ Speech-Language Pathology licensure.
Job Tasks
- Provide direct speech-language therapy services across a variety of locations, including CAU's day habilitation program, members' homes, and community-based sites.
- Develop and implement individualized treatment plans aligned with members' needs and preferences.
- Collaborate with the Assistive Technology Department to conduct comprehensive AAC (augmentative-alternative communication) evaluations for individuals across day program and community settings, including feature matching, trials, and report writing.
- Purchase, deliver, set up, and customize AAC equipment.
- Train communication partners (staff, family, peers) on AAC device use, implementation strategies, and supportive communication techniques.
- Collaborate with interdisciplinary teams, caregivers, direct support professionals, and other stakeholders to support carryover of communication strategies across environments.
- Maintain accurate and timely clinical documentation including session notes, evaluation reports, and treatment plans in accordance with regulatory and organizational standards.
- Provide staff training on communication supports and perform fidelity checks to ensure treatment plans/recommendations are being followed.
- Participate in team meetings and interdisciplinary planning as needed.
- Collaborate with interdisciplinary teams to integrate services, improving outcomes and member satisfaction. Identify areas for improvement and suggest initiatives to enhance service delivery and member care.
- Collaborate with community organizations to expand service reach and impact.
- Coordinate NJISP and SDR approvals with support coordination agencies for speech and/or AT services.
- Maintain all services in our Electronic Health Records software. Ensure all assessments are signed and scanned for Medicaid billing.
